This is one of those books where I’m pretty sure it’ll be a 5 star on reread, but I can’t quite give it that rating yet at the moment. The big plus of this book is the relationship between Jainan and Kiem and their slow burn romance. All the wonderful romance tropes you know and love in a scifi coating. It took me a little bit to warm up to the main characters but once I did, they completely had me. Great side characters too, I loved Bel especially. Where the book lost me a little bit was the scifi plot and worldbuilding, I was just a bit confused for a long time, especially in the first half which is rather slow. But like I said: I’m sure I’ll reread this and suddenly understand it all and give this the extra star it deserves.

This book was great for people wanting to read sci-fi but get overwhelmed by the thought of it.  Besides few names I had to look up the pronunciation of, it was fairly easy to read.  I enjoyed how well the sci-fi and romance mixed with this book, there was also a bit of mystery to the plot as well.

Kiem was honestly such a lovable idiot and worked so well with Jainan.  I would have liked a little more romance but the plot was good too.  The romance itself is a bit of a slow burn, the main plot, focusing much more on the political scheming, and an alleged murder that might just be a cover-up, and in general dealing with diplomatic relations.

So much happened in this, so little to care about.

Winter's Orbit is a sci-fi romance novel that can't quite commit to any of its bits. Relying too heavily on its tropes, I found the main characters flat and lacking in chemistry. The slow-burn didn't work, it either needed to be less slow or more tension, and it most definitely needed less miscommunication.

The sci-fi setting is wasted. The world building is both convoluted and flat. It's intensely focused on the politics of an interstellar empire but forgets to really flesh said empire out, so we get a lot of political intrigue that isn't intriguing. And the sci-fi concepts are half-baked and under-utilized.

Overall, wish this was more romantic and speculative. As a gay who loves space operas, I'm disappointed in this gay space opera.
